The Java developer will be responsible for writing code to build and support enterprise applications.
This role will interface with the business and other developers to ensure business requirements are translated into detailed technical specifications.
Bachelors Degree in Computer Science, or related computer field. 3 years of minimum experience in Java software development. Strong knowledge of core Java, J2EE, Angular.JS. Object Oriented Design skills and understanding of design patterns. Knowledge of +SQL and understanding of relational databases Strong communication skills (verbal and written). Desired Skills: Experience with writing end to end web applications or components. Experience with UI frameworks JavaScript, Angular. Experience or knowledge in latest Angular version. Experience working in agile methodologies. Excellent analytical, organizational and problem-solving skills coupled with a strong work ethic. Passion to learn new technologies as needed. Bonus points if you have experience coding in life insurance domain & building CRM application.